The king’s loyalist army defeats the insurrectionists, but David is overcome with grief over his son’s death. Joab warns David that he risks another civil war unless he appears to the people and re-assumes his kingship authority. “Then the king arose and sat in the gate. And they told all the people, saying, ‘There is the king, sitting in the gate’” (2 Samuel 19:8 NKJV). The people rally around him, and David returns to Jerusalem.
We see parallels between these events in King David’s life and how people respond to Jesus today as well as the folly of looking to man instead of God for hope and deliverance. Only in Jesus do we have a sure and certain hope for all eternity. This Christmas season, Pastor Kevin exhorts believers to share the gospel, the greatest gift of all, while there is still time.
